The first task this morning was to strip down the trial fit and isolate the cylinder. I have to drill the steam passage from the cylinder to the steam port. Needless to say this is not as easy as it looks. My method is to mark the exit point into the steam port on the outside of the cylinder and use that to set the vice at the right angle. It's always an educated guess and touch wood has always worked for me.

Image

Here we are set up and ready to put a flat in the entry point so the N0 40 drill can enter straight.

Image

Here we are with the drill fitted and the hole is drilled. The piece of paper in the jaw of the vice is a tell tale. You can't see into the port but you want to stop drilling when your drill has entered the port. When you do cast iron dust drops on the paper and gives you an accurate warning of entry. (As long as you got the angle right in the first place and here we did.)

Image

Here we are, both ports bored and as near dead accurate as makes no difference. Big sigh of relief..... :biggrin2:

Today's task was easily identified. We have a cylinder, we need a piston. First stage was to turn the bronze provided down to the diameter needed. The size is checked in the usual way!

Image

The piston has its oil grooves (no piston ring or seal) and I have drilled it with a No37 drill and here we are tapping it 5BA.

Image

Part it off...

Image

Turn the end of the piston rod down to threading diameter for 5BA and then thread it.

Image

I honed the cylinder bore using this expensive tool, a big split pin with emery cloth threaded through it.

Image

My knees were hurting so an early shut down but we have a piston and the beginnings of a rod. I shall carry on tomorrow. Slow and careful, but no cock-ups. :biggrin2:

We need to work on the con-rod. First thing was to get it in the lathe, clean up the periphery and the rod and cut the spigot off provided for chucking. Then pop it back in the chuck to clean the base up.

Image

Image

Then mark for the two bolts that will hold the bearing cap on and set up and drill in the VM. This is not on the drawing because the Stuart way is to cheat and put the bearing on the crank pin when building the shaft up from individual parts. I shall be making the crankshaft the traditional way out of solid and so need a split bearing to mount it.

Image

Image

I fitted two retaining bolts for use when the bearing is fitted. Put some finish on the cheeks of the bearing and than marked it for splitting into two halves. I enjoyed this morning and I think we have good progress.
